Output 931cbcd616b04b56ba96c118b11e91dce7332814711229aece6fcb38687b7311:27

value
653087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c58881f09785e11736c101698b4179a0560707c OP_EQUAL
address
34GtuCxboBTTYHrtUxnwdM4n4N4k9ZJKXy
transaction
931cbcd616b04b56ba96c118b11e91dce7332814711229aece6fcb38687b7311
spent
true